Erin turtenwald
OWNER/FOUNDER/DESIGNER/COLOR EXPERT
My journey in design started at 15, working alongside my dad to renovate homes and learning not just how spaces look but how they function. That early foundation shaped everything: a deep understanding of flow, proportion, and the integrity of older homes, along with a lasting appreciation for thoughtful restoration.
In my twenties, I built a career in accounting and finance, working in public accounting and later in the investment industry. At the same time, I was buying and renovating my own properties, eventually completing eight full home renovations. What began as a personal passion quickly gained momentum, as others were drawn to the way I approached space: with both creativity and strategy.
As demand grew, I began taking on client projects, and before long, I had a full design business and stepped away from corporate life to run my firm full-time in Milwaukee.
After relocating to Seattle, I briefly returned to the corporate world as a CFO for a real estate investment company but it clarified what I already knew: I’m at my best building something of my own. While continuing to book design work, I made the decision to leave that role and fully commit to my next chapter launching The Shop.
Founded in 2025, The Shop was born from a vision of creating a small, creative studio where clients and customers can bring their home dreams to life. Whether sourcing those final, hard-to-find pieces that complete a space, discovering a unique and meaningful gift, or building something from the ground up, the goal is to offer a thoughtful, highly personal approach to design that meets people wherever they are in the process.
Today, my work is rooted in that unique blend of experience: construction knowledge, financial insight, and an intuitive approach to design. I create spaces that are not only beautiful, but highly functional, deeply considered, and built to last.

Jennifer MULLALLY
DESIGNER
Jennifer began her career in interior design in 2012, cultivating a body of work that spans Seattle, San Francisco, Sun Valley, Palm Desert, and Boise. Her approach to design is rooted in a deep appreciation for timeless architecture, with a particular affinity for historic homes and the stories they hold.
Known for her ability to create highly personalized interiors, Jennifer's work is defined by thoughtful customization and distinctive, one-of-a-kind details. She believes the most compelling spaces are those that feel deeply individualized, where every element is intentionally curated to reflect both the home and the people who live within it.
Raised on a small horse farm in Washington, Jennifer developed an early understanding of space, craftsmanship, and the connection between home and lifestyle-principles that continue to inform her work today. She brings a layered perspective to her designs, blending a sense of heritage with a refined, livable elegance.
Coming from a close-knit family of four sisters and a brother, Jennifer values connection and authenticity, qualities that shape both her client relationships and her design philosophy. She lives with her husband, Michael, and her three children, who remain her greatest source of inspiration.
